A car's wheelbase-the distance between the front and rear axles-is primarily determined by the vehicle's design and intended purpose. Several key factors influence this:

Vehicle Class and Size:
Compact cars have shorter wheelbases for better maneuverability, while SUVs, trucks, and luxury sedans often have longer wheelbases for more interior space and stability.
Interior Space Requirements:
A longer wheelbase allows for more cabin and legroom, especially for rear-seat passengers.
Handling and Ride Comfort:
A shorter wheelbase generally improves agility and turning radius, making the car easier to handle in tight spaces.
A longer wheelbase tends to offer a smoother ride and better stability at high speeds, especially on rough roads.
Platform Architecture:
Automakers often design multiple models on the same platform, which can influence wheelbase dimensions for production efficiency.
Weight Distribution and Suspension Design:
Engineers adjust the wheelbase to help balance the car's weight and optimize suspension geometry for handling and comfort.
Conclusion:
The wheelbase is a result of careful engineering, balancing performance, comfort, space, and design goals. It's not randomly chosen-it serves the vehicle's overall purpose and character.
